The Minister of Finance and Development Planning Baledzi Gaolathe is in Malaysia attending a poverty-reduction conference on behalf of President Festus Mogae.

The conference is the 8th edition of the Langkawi International Dialogue 2007 (LID2007).
The theme for this year's meeting, which started yesterday and ends tomorrow, is "Poverty Reduction Through Human Capital Development and Capacity Building".
Since its inception, the aim of the LID has been to promote principles of smart partnership among nations, nationalities, governments, business and communities.

Smart partnership is a concept that promotes networking, exchanging ideas, importing knowledge, and trading with and extending support to one another for mutual benefit.
LID is part of the Smart Partnership Dialogue series implemented by the Commonwealth Partnership for Technology Management (CPTM) to promote partnership between both the public and the private sector.
